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 193 -- Summoning of person as accused - Court of Session takes cognizance of the case or offence as a whole and therefore is entitled to summon anyone who on the material before it appears to be involved in such offence to stand for trial before it...........
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 190, 193 -- Cognizance of offence - Summoning of person as offender - Unless the court has taken cognizance of offence, a person merely alleged or suspected to be involved in the commission of such offence, cannot be called upon or compelled to partake in criminal proceedings as it violates the person`s right to dignity and the right..........
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 190 -- Cognizance of offence - Any offence - Magistrate is empowered to take cognizance of an offence even if the same is triable exclusively by the court of session...........
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 190, 193 -- Cognizance - Cognizance is of an offence and not the offender - Therefore, in absence of an offence, no cognizance can be take and no proceedings can be initiated...........
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 227 -- Discharge - Discharge of an accused does not mean that no offence had occurred in the first place...........
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 227 -- Discharge - Cognizance is always qua an offence and relates to initiation of proceedings, whereas discharge is only in respect of an accused and concerned with the existence of sufficient ground to proceed against accused...........
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 193, 319 -- Cognizance of offence by Court of Session - Summoning of person as accused u/S. 193 - It is not proper for Court of Session to wait till the stage u/S. 319 CR.P.C to proceed against the person against whom prima facie case is made out from the material contained in case paper sent by the Magistrate while committing the..........
Criminal Procedure Code, 1973, Section 193 -- Cognizance of offence - Summoning of person as accused - Court of Session has power u/S. 193 Cr.P.C to summon a person as accused to stand trial, even if he has not been charge-sheeted by the police and whose complexity in the crime appears in evidence available on record...........
